Everything You Need To Know About The Nike Adapt BB

The future of basketball sneakers has arrived. Earlier today Nike Basketball unveiled their first-ever auto-lacing basketball shoe, the Nike Adapt BB.

The Nike Adapt BB is designed to give you a customized, consistent fit as it adapts to your foot to provide a locked-in feel for distraction-free play. The Nike Adapt BB can be paired up with the Nike Adapt app to fine-tune the fit and customize the features from your smartphone.

?We picked basketball as the first sport for Nike Adapt intentionally because of the demands that athletes put on their shoes,? says Eric Avar, Nike VP Creative Director of Innovation. ?During a normal basketball game the athlete?s foot changes and the ability to quickly change your fit by loosening your shoe to increase blood flow and then tighten again for performance is a key element that we believe will improve the athlete?s experience.?

How The Shoe Works

When a player steps into the Nike Adapt BB, a custom motor and gear train senses the tension needed by the foot and adjusts accordingly to keep the foot snug. The tensile strength of the underfoot lacing is able to pull 32 pounds of force (roughly equal to that of a standard parachute cord) to secure the foot throughout a range of movement.

That?s where the brain, or FitAdapt tech, kicks in. By manual touch or by using the Nike Adapt app on a smartphone, players can input different fit settings depending on different moments of a game. For example, during a timeout, a player can loosen the shoe before tightening it up as they re-enter the game. In a forthcoming feature, they can even prescribe a different tightness setting for warm-ups. Plus, players can opt in to firmware updates for the FitAdapt technology as they become available, sharpening the precision of fit for players and providing new digital services over time.

How It Was Tested

Similar to the HyperAdapt 1.0, the Nike Adapt BB was put through a gauntlet of tests, including impact tests, intense temperatures, end-of-life tests that lasted tens of thousands of cycles long, waterproof tests to simulate the sweatiest feet and more.

Where It?s Headed

Nike Adapt BB is the first continually updated performance product from Nike due to the near-symbiotic relationship between the shoe?s digital app and the shoe?s opt-in firmware updates. As the FitAdapt system hones the quality of fit in basketball, the next step will be to bring FitAdapt to other sports and lifestyle products, each with unique demands for fit in different environments.

 

Look for the Nike Adapt BB to release on February 17th at select Nike Basketball retailers and Nike SNKRS for the retail price of $350.

Are You Copping The Nike React Element 87 Light Orewood

The Nike React Element 87 Light Orewood Brown is the next iteration of the popular silhouette to kick off the new year. The sneaker’s highlight element with the translucent upper reveals the Light Orewood theme, while suede accents for its eyelets is colored in cool grey. More grey is applied on the heel, along with pops of orange, with more orange used for the Swooshes and branded areas. Finally, a white React foam cushioned sole and hits of volt across completes the style.

Retailing for $160, look for the Nike React Element 87 Light Orewood Brown at select Nike stores and online on January 29. Always keep it locked to KicksOnFire for the latest in sneaker news, release dates and where to purchase your favorite kicks.

Are You Waiting For The Nike Zoom Kobe 1 Protro 81 Points

The Nike Zoom Kobe 1 Protro 81 Points honors the 13th anniversary of Kobe Bryant’s career high 81-point game versus the Toronto Raptors, and it’s officially dropping later this week. Covered in the Lakers? signatures colors with white leather used for majority of the upper, contrasting purple is applied on the ankle collar and midsole, then black for the Swooshes. Finally, carbon fiber detailing along a portion of the midsole completes the theme.

Look for the Nike Zoom Kobe 1 Protro 81 Points at select Nike stores in North America and online on January 22 for $175. Always keep it locked to KicksOnFire for the latest in sneaker news, release dates and where to purchase your favorite kicks.
